Easy Peach Cobbler
Ingredients
1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ted
1 cup all-purpose flour
1 cup sugar
3 tsp baking powder
Pinch of salt
1 cup milk
4 cups peeled, pitted and thinly sliced fresh peaches (5 to 6 medium peaches)
1 tablespoon fresh lemon juice
Several dashes of ground cinnamon or ground nutmeg (optional)

Directions
Preheat oven to 375 degrees.
Pour the melted
butter into a 13 by 9 by 2-inch baking dish.
In a medium bowl,
combine the flour, 1 cup sugar, the baking powder, and the salt and mix well.
Stir in the milk, mixing until just combined. Pour this batter over the butter
but do not stir them together.
In a small saucepan,
combine the peaches, lemon juice, and remaining cup of sugar and bring to a
boil over high heat, stirring constantly. Pour the peaches over the batter but
do not stir them together. Sprinkle with cinnamon or nutmeg if desired.
